Jamie Zawinski <jwz at jwz.org> writes:

> XEmacs 21.5  (beta28) "fuki" (+CVS-20071205) [Lucid] (i386-apple-
> darwin9.1.0, Mule) of Wed Jan  2 2008
>
> In a terminal:
> /Applications/XEmacs.app/Contents/MacOS/XEmacs -nw -q
>
> C-x 2 C-x 2		; 3 windows, of 4, 5, and 11 lines respectively
> M-x
> C-g			; 3 windows, of 4, 7, and 9 lines respectively
> M-x
> C-g			; 3 windows, of 4, 13, and 3 lines respectively
>
> This happens in either terminal-mode or Cocoa windowed mode.
>
> It does not happen with an X11 build of 21.4.20.
>
> Other than that, I don't know whether this is a general xemacs
> regression, or related to the Cocoa code.

It's general and probably my fault.  (I rewrote the window-config code
in Elisp for 21.5.)  I'll add it to my list.  Thanks for the report!  (I
had previous reports that looked similar to this, but this is the first
one that's I can reproduce.)
